Gary Smith


profile01

6th July, 12:30 – 1:30pm

Free admission


Garry Smith plays a resophonic guitar, mostly slide with Blues on the side. Relying mostly on self-penned songs and instrumentals, he also covers artists such as Tom Waits, Steve Earl and Richard Thompson. 

Blues and English / Irish Folk Music. 

Gary explores the possibilities open to the slide guitarist, by going beyond the repertoire expected.

Recent performances include Bracknell Guitar Festival

Gary has supported artists such as Steve Tilston, Sarah McQuaid and Peter Case.

 The next free lunchtime concert at OPEN Ealing.

 Date:    Friday 4th May

 OPEN's regular 'First Friday' music event venture

  Into the World of Broadway Musicals  


  Time:   12.30-1.30

 Theme: Broadway Musicals

 Venue: OPEN Ealing Arts Centre

 113 Uxbridge Road, London, W5 5TL

 

 Performers:  3rd year music students from the University of West London playing excerpts from their  forthcoming production of Kander and Ebb’s Flora the Red Menace.

 Best known for writing the hugely successful musical Cabaret, Flora the Red Menace was John Kander and  Fred Ebb’s first Broadway musical.
